SCI-TECH MEDIA | Twitter rival Threads crosses 10 million users within hours of launch
This photo illustration created in Washington, DC, on July 5, 2023, shows the Twitter logo reflected near the logo for
Read moreThis photo illustration created in Washington, DC, on July 5, 2023, shows the Twitter logo reflected near the logo for
Read moreThis photo illustration created in Washington, DC, on July 5, 2023, shows the Twitter logo reflected near the logo for
Read more